From the Streets to Success: How John Turned His Hard Life into a Million-Dollar Dream

John’s journey from being homeless to becoming a self-made millionaire is one of courage, faith, and determination.

His story is a powerful reminder that no situation in life is permanent — and that hope, hard work, and persistence can transform even the darkest moments into success.

As a teenager, John found himself on the streets after his parents separated and life at home became unbearable.

With no money, no education, and no one to depend on, he spent several years sleeping in abandoned buildings and surviving on scraps. “I used to beg for food every day,” he recalls. “There were nights when I slept hungry, but I always told myself things would not stay that way forever.”

Despite the constant struggle, John never gave up on his dream of living a better life. His turning point came when he met a group of community volunteers who were working with Magongo Doctors, an organization known for offering health and life support services to people in need.

Through their guidance, John received medical care, counselling, and mentorship that helped him regain confidence and plan for his future.

With a small grant from the program, John started selling handmade crafts and herbal products. He later saved enough money to open a small shop in Kampala, where his business quickly grew.

Over time, John expanded into the cosmetics and natural health industry — and today, he owns a chain of wellness shops employing dozens of people across Uganda.

“Success didn’t come overnight,” John says. “I failed many times, but each failure taught me something. What matters most is never losing hope and believing that your dream is possible.”

John now uses part of his earnings to support street children and struggling families, providing them with food, education, and small business grants.

His story continues to inspire many Ugandans who are fighting to overcome poverty and hardship.
